What is Cloud Event-Based Function Processing?

Before we dive into the future of cloud event-based function processing, let's first define what it is. Cloud event-based function processing is a way of developing and deploying applications that are triggered by events. These events can be anything from a user clicking a button to a sensor detecting a change in temperature. When an event occurs, a function is triggered, and the application responds accordingly.

The Current State of Cloud Event-Based Function Processing

Cloud event-based function processing is not a new concept. It has been around for several years, and many cloud providers offer services that support it. The most popular of these services is AWS Lambda, which was launched in 2014. Since then, many other cloud providers have launched similar services, including Google Cloud Functions and Microsoft Azure Functions.

Today, cloud event-based function processing is widely used in the development of serverless applications. Serverless applications are applications that do not require the developer to manage the underlying infrastructure. Instead, the cloud provider manages the infrastructure, and the developer only needs to focus on writing the application code.

The Future of Cloud Event-Based Function Processing

So, what does the future of cloud event-based function processing look like? In short, it looks bright! Here are some of the trends that we can expect to see in the coming years:

Increased Adoption of Serverless

Serverless is already popular, but we can expect to see even more adoption in the coming years. This is because serverless offers several benefits over traditional application development, including reduced costs, increased scalability, and faster time to market.

More Cloud Providers Offering Event-Based Function Processing

As the demand for serverless continues to grow, we can expect to see more cloud providers offering event-based function processing. This will increase competition in the market, which will ultimately benefit developers by driving down costs and improving service quality.

Greater Integration with Other Cloud Services

Cloud event-based function processing is not an isolated service. It is often used in conjunction with other cloud services, such as databases, message queues, and storage services. In the future, we can expect to see even greater integration between these services, making it easier for developers to build complex applications.

More Advanced Event Processing

Today, cloud event-based function processing is primarily used for simple event processing, such as triggering a function when a user clicks a button. In the future, we can expect to see more advanced event processing, such as machine learning models that trigger functions based on complex patterns in data.

Increased Focus on Security

As cloud event-based function processing becomes more popular, we can expect to see an increased focus on security. This will include better encryption, more robust access controls, and improved monitoring and logging.
